Remington Furloughs Employees, Shutters Production Lines

Remington Arms, amid bankruptcy proceedings and reeling from a decline in production demand, will furlough almost 500 employees from its Alabama and New York plants for two months in summer 2019.

New RISE Armament RA-140 Flat Super Sporting Trigger

The new low-cost, high performance RISE Armament RA-140 Flat SST drop-in trigger boasts a clean break at 3.5 pounds with a short reset.

Ruger Reintroduces Hawkeye Alaskan Rifle

Based on the Ruger Guide Gun platform, the reintroduced Hawkeye Alaska rifle sports a Hogue OverMolded stock and matte stainless finish.
